Brief Summary
RATIONALE: Collecting and storing samples of blood from patients with cancer to study in the laboratory may help doctors learn more about cancer and identify biomarkers related to cancer.
PURPOSE: This laboratory study is looking at biomarkers of angiogenesis and disease in patients with unresectable malignant mesothelioma treated on clinical trial CALGB-30107.
Detailed Description
OBJECTIVES: * Determine if elevated levels of thrombospondin I serum levels, vascular endothelial growth factor receptor I, fibroblast growth factor, transforming growth factor, and mesothelin portend a poor prognosis in patients with unresectable malignant mesothelioma treated with vatalanib on protocol CALGB-30107. * Determine if elevated levels of thrombospondin I serum levels, vascular endothelial growth factor receptor I, fibroblast growth factor, transforming growth factor, and mesothelin correlate with response or stable disease in these patients. OUTLINE: Serum samples previously obtained from patients on protocol CALGB-30107 are tested for levels of thrombospondin I serum, vascular endothelial growth factor receptor I, fibroblast growth factor, transforming growth factor, and mesothelin using enzyme-linked immunosorbent assays (ELISA). PROJECTED ACCRUAL: A total of 47 specimens will be accrued for this study.
